TUC RAIL was put in charge of designing and supervising construction of the high speed rail network in Belgium. Its main responsibilities concerned feasibility studies, preliminary studies (including ground surveys), project and construction plans, detailed engineering studies, technical specifications, worksite inspection and supervision, analysis and comparison of bids, overall management of the project and final acceptance.
ThehighspeedlineslinkBrussels,AntwerpandLiegetothemaincitiesofneighboringcountries(Paris,London,Cologne,RotterdamandAmsterdam),therebyformingthefirstinternationalhighspeednetworkinEurope.InBelgium,thehighspeedrail(HSR)networkconsistsof314kmofrailroad,including200kmofnewtrack.Theremainderismadeupoftrackswhichhavebeenmodernizedandadaptedforhighspeeduse.Itismadeupofthreemainbranches:theWestern,EasternandNorthernbranches.
Western branchTUCRAILdesignedandconstructedtheWesternbranchoftheHSRnetworkinBelgiumbetweenBrusselsandtheFrenchborder,aprojectwhichtooklessthanfiveyearstocomplete.Therouteincludes88kmofrailroad,incorporating71kmofnewtracksand17kmofmodifiedtracks.
Eastern branchThebranchbetweenBrusselsandtheGermanborderconsistsof33kmofexistinglinebetweenBrusselsandLeuven,whichwasmodernized,62kmofnewlinebetweenLeuvenandBiersetand54kmofneworrenovatedlinebetweenBiersetandtheGermanborder.Themaximumspeedonthenewtracksis320km/h.
Northern branchThisbranch,linkingBrusselswiththeDutchborder,consistsof46kmofmodernizedandmodifiedtracksbetweenBrusselsandAntwerp,5kmofpartiallymodernized/newlinesinthecityofAntwerpand35kmofnewhighspeedlinesbetweenAntwerpandtheDutchborder.

Regional Express Network
The construction of the Regional Express Network (RER) in and around Brussels is currently one of TUC RAIL’s biggest projects. The RER will provide a solution to the increasing gridlock on the road network in and around Brussels, gridlock which has disastrous consequences for the environment. Mobility within a 30 km radius of the capital will be considerably improved by increasing capacity on the main rail lines into and out of Brussels. This increased capacity has already been partially achieved as part of the high speed rail works and needs to be completed with the switching of three lines to a 4-track alignment and the construction of the new Schuman-Josaphat tunnel. The RER is a wide-ranging, complex project which cannot be summarized in a few lines. The text below outlines the main elements of the project.
TheRERprojectconcernsLine161(Ottignies–Brussels)whichhasbeensplitintotwosegments,namelytheOttigniestoWatermaelpartandtheWatermaeltoJosaphatpart(includingthenewSchuman-Josaphattunnel),Line124(Nivelles–Brussels)andLine50A(Denderleeuw–Brussels-Midi).TUCRAILhasbeenappointedbyInfrabeltoprovideprojectmanagement,designandsupervisionoftheworkstoswitchthesethreelinestoa4-trackalignment.Importantinfrastructuralworksarecurrentlyunderway,includingthemodificationorrenovationoftrackbeds,tracks,overheadlines,bridges,tunnels,stopsandstations.
Line161iscurrentlyonecontinuousconstructionsitebetweenSchumanstationandtheLouvain-la-Neuvejunction.TheWatermaelSchumanJosaphatprogramwasfirsttobegin,andisthereforethemostadvancedofthefourRERprograms.ConstructionoftheSchuman-Josaphattunnelisapproachingcompletion,andtheinstallationoftherailequipmentstarted
thisyear.TheopensectionalongtheexistinglinebetweenSchumanandWatermaeliscompleted.Onlytheendsofthesectionarestillunderconstruction:totheNorththerenovationofSchumanstationandtotheSouththeredevelopmentofthetracksintheso-called“Etterbeek”triangle.
CivilengineeringworksarewellunderwayintheWatermael-Ottigniesprogram.Fouroftheninecivilengineeringsiteswillshortlybecompleted:Ottignies-Sud,Hoeilaart,Limal-LimeletteandGenval.

Concentration of signal boxes
Concentration of signal boxes
After completing the TGV network in Belgium, TUC RAIL was awarded several contracts for the construction of large scale projects. One of these projects involves the concentration of the signal boxes on the Belgian railroad network.
Underthiscontract,InfrabelhasentrustedTUCRAILwithresponsibilityforprovidingoverallprojectmanagementaswellasjointlyassistingwiththeupgradingofthesignalingsystemontheBelgianrailroadnetwork.Thesignalboxconcentrationprojectsareofvitalimportanceastheyrelatetothesafetyoftherailroadnetwork,whichisoneofInfrabel’skeystrategicfocusareas.
Atthebeginningoftheproject,theBelgiannetworkwascontrolledby368signalingstations,eachboxbeingoccupiedbyoperatorswhomanagerailtrafficviaroutes(usingsignals-pointswitching–traindetectors).Theultimateobjectiveoftheprojectistoconcentratethesestationsinto31operationalstationswithanadditional11localcommandstationswhichcanberemotelycontrolledbyoneofthe31finalstations(forfacilitieswithlargesortingsidingsforfreighttrains).
Insomecases,concentrationofthesignalboxesinvolvesreplacingtheexistinginstallationwithultramodernelectronicinterlocking.Thismeansenhancedsafety,greaterregularityandbetterinformationaboutrailroadtraffic.

Thetechnologyusedtosafelycontrolandmonitortrainmovementsisfullycomputerizedandallowsforequipmenttobecontrolled(signals-pointswitches)withinaradiusof10to100km.Thiscontrastswiththetraditionalsignalingstationswhichwerelimitedtoadistanceof5to6km.
Thefullconcentrationandmodernizationprocesscanonlybecompletedifcertainancillarytechnicalconditions,notdirectlyrelatedtothesignalingsystemitself,arefulfilled.Itis,forexample,essentialthattransmissionofinformationbetweentheequipmentonthegroundandthesignalboxshouldbedoneviaafiberopticnetworkandthatpowersuppliestotheequipmentbemademoresecureusingaredundantpowersupplysystem.
Thenewcentralizedsystemwillbemoreuser-friendlyandergonomicandthereforeeasiertooperatethantheolderequipment.Inaddition,train-relatedinformationwillbeanalyzedinanentirelydifferentway,comparedtothepast,whichwillbemoreefficient.
InfrabelSignalisationisresponsibleforthetechnicaloversightofthisprojectinordertoensurethesafetyofthesignalingsystemsinstalled.TUCRAILisinchargeofprogrammanagement.Itsmissionistomakesurethattheentireprojectiscarriedout.Alsoincludedaredesign,coordinationofcertainworksexecutedbythirdpartiesandfunctionaltests.Thisprogramalsoinvolvestheconstructionof17newsignalboxes.Anotherpartoftheprogramconsistsoftheconstructionand/ortheequipmentforthefeederstationsand1,000voltsupplytopowerthenewsignalingequipment.Asregardsconstructionwork,TUCRAILisinvolvedinreplacingthesignalingsysteminseveralstationsandinstallingthesignalingsystemoncertainsectionsoftheBelgiannetwork.

Improving access to airports
Mobility is a big issue in Belgium. TUC RAIL is playing its part in improving mobility through different projects including, among others, improving rail access to the airports. The objective is to make the airports more accessible and provide an efficient link between the airports and the major cities in neighboring countries.
Brussels AirportWithintheframeworkoftheDiaboloproject,TUCRAILwasresponsiblefortheoverallprogrammanagement,thedesignandsupervisionoftheDiaboloworksexecutedwithintheframeworkofaPublicPrivatePartnership(PPP),i.e.essentiallytheboringofthetunnelundertheairportandBrucargosites.
TUCRAILhadalreadyworkedwithintheframeworkofaPPPforothercustomersinthepast.Infrabelwasthusabletobenefitfromthecompany’sexperience,amajorassetforthemanagementofthecontractualaspectsrequiredbytheconstructionsbuiltwithintheframeworkofthePPP.ThisalsoallowedTUCRAILtodemonstratetheflexibilityneededtomanagethevariousinterestsofthepartnersconcerned.
TUCRAILthereforedeliveredwhatcouldbetermedasa“turnkey”projecttoitscustomer,Infrabel,insofarastheinfrastructuredeliveredwascompletelyreadytobeputintoservice.WorkingwithintheframeworkofaPPPhadseveralimplications.Thestructureofthecontractwasverydifferent,whichmeantdevisinganothermethodofnegotiation.

Moreover,theDiaboloprojectbroughttogetheragreaternumberofpartnersthaninatraditionalproject,whichledTUCRAILandInfrabeltoadoptseveralroles.
Theentireprojectlastednearlysevenyears.Thepreparatorystudiesdatefrom2005.Theyincludedthepreliminarystudies,thepermitrequestsanddrawingupthespecifications.TheworksonthecentralreservationoftheE19freewaybeganon2ndJuly2007.TheworksrelatingtothepartfallingunderthescopeofthePPPbeganendOctober2007,whereastheworksintheBrussels-CapitalRegionbeganatthebeginningofAugust2009.Theentireinfrastructurewasfinalised,testedandvalidatedinlinewiththeschedule.
TherailwaytunnelboredfortheDiabolostartsatBrusselsNationalAirportrailwaystation(cut-and-covertunnelapproximately400mlong).Itthenpassesunderthetake-offandlandingstrips(boredtunnelwithtwo1070-mlongtubes).ItcontinuesundertheBrucargoarea(450-metrelongcut-and-covertunnel)andthenundertheMacheleninterchange.Itthenresurfacesonthecentralreservationwhereitjoinsthenew25NlinelinkingSchaerbeekandMalines.Theboringofthedoubletunnelhadtobeoftheutmostprecisionbecausetheleastgroundsubsidencecouldhavedisastrousconsequencesforaplanetakingofforlanding.Itwaspossibletoborethetwintunnelwithadeviationof
lessthantwocentimetres,aremarkablemarginwellbelowthetolerancemargin.
Theovergroundworksarecenteredonthenew25NlinewhichpassesonthecentralreservationoftheE19freeway.Althoughtheyarelessspectacularthantheundergroundworks,theyareneverthelessanotablefeat.Thedesignofthe150-mlongZemstbridgeisagoodexample.TUCRAILalsobuiltthe“Iris”viaduct:820mlongand20mhigh,itstandson42pillarstoppedoffwithaniris,thesymboloftheBrussels-CapitalRegion.AsforthebridgeontheWoluwelaan,itisanintegralbridgewhosethreefloorslabsareconnectedasamonolithtotheabutments.Builtasanarchbridge,ithasaspanof90m.

Axis between Ghent and the coast
Axis between Ghent and the coast
To respond to the increase in passenger traffic and actively support the commercial development and expansion of Zeebrugge port, Infrabel is currently carrying out various infrastructural works between Ghent and Zeebrugge. A third and fourth track are currently being developed between Ghent and Bruges while a third track is being installed between Bruges and Dudzele. Due to the combination of slow and fast trains, the existing line has already been operating at full capacity for a number of years. This means that it is no longer possible to add any additional trains and delays cannot therefore be reduced. The additional rail infrastructure will therefore allow for improved links with the hinterland for freight-related transport, as well as a smoother flow of passenger traffic.
Two additional tracks between Ghent and Bruges ThisprogramincorporatesthedevelopmentofathirdandfourthtrackbetweenGhentandBruges,overadistanceofapproximately30km.Thelayingoftheseadditionaltrackswillenableslowtraintraffictobeseparatedfromfasttrains.ThecapacityoftherailroadlinelinkingGhenttoBrugeswillthereforebeincreased.
Thisincreaseincapacityinvolvestheremovalofalllevelcrossingsontheroute,theirreplacementwithnewbridgesandtunnels,ordevelopmentofnewroadsrunningalongsidethetrackslinkingupwithexistingbridgesortunnels.Retaininglevelcrossingsonafour-tracklinewouldactuallyinvolveanincreaseinthedurationandfrequencyofgateclosedperiods,resultinginlongwaitingtimesforroadusers.Removingthelevelcrossingswouldalsopreventanyaccidentsinvolvingroadtraffic.

Improving access to Antwerp port
Liefkenshoek rail linkTheLiefkenshoekraillinkisadirectlinkbetweentheleftandrightbanksoftheScheldt.Itisaimedatrespondingtotheexpectedconsiderablegrowthinfreighttrafficintheregionintheyearsahead.
ThenewraillinkwillrelievepressureonthebusyAntwerp-Berchemintersection,andalsosignificantlycutthejourneytimeforgoodstrafficbetweentheLeftandRightBanks.
Thenewlinkconsistsofatwo-trackstretch16.2kmlongrunningfromthewesternbundleheadoftheexistingSouthbundleontheLeftBank.FromtherethenewrailwaylinerunsparalleltotheE34/N49freewayandtotheR2fromtheE34/N49-R2interchange.The

longitudinalprofilestartstodrop,beforepassingundertheWaaslandcanalfurtheronviatheexistingbutneverusedBeverenrailtunnel.AftertheBeverentunnelthetrackcontinuesunderground,inanopencuttingparalleltotheR2.Via2parallelsingle-trackdrilledtunnelshaftseach6kmlongthenewlinethenpassesundertheScheldtandthecanaldockbeforejoiningupwithLine11andAntwerp-NordmarshallingyardontheRightBank.
ThecivilengineeringcomponentoftheprojectwillbecarriedoutbymeansofaDBFMcontractunderaPublicPrivatePartnership(PPP).AprivatepartnershipwillberesponsibleforDesign,Building,FinanceandMaintenanceofthenewinfrastructure.LOCORAIL,aconsortiumspecificallysetupforthispurpose,composedofBAMPPP,CFEandVinciConcessions,hasbeenselectedastheprivatepartnerforthis
project.LOCORAILwillhandovertheinfrastructuretoInfrabelforaperiodof38years.Infrabelwillpayanavailabilitypaymentperyear.Attheendofthis38yearperiod,theinfrastructurewillbetransferredtoInfrabelfreeofcharge.
Giventhelengthofthetunnels,particularattentionwaspaidtosafetyinthem.Adetailedsafetystudywasusedasabasisfordeterminingthemostappropriatesafetymeasures.Thisisexpressedinboththepassiveandactivefiresafetymeasures.
Unlikeinpassengertunnels,whereincaseoffirethesafeevacuationofpassengerstakespriority,intheeventofafireinagoodstunnelthepriorityistoputthefireoutasquicklyaspossible.Thisisbecausethefireloadofgoodstrainscanbeveryhigh,whichcouldjeopardizethestructuralintegrityofthetunnel.Hencethechoiceofanautomaticfoamextinguishingsystem,thefirstofitskindinBelgium.
Variousothersafetymeasureswerealsoincorporatedintothedesign.Forexample,severalevacuationshaftsandcross-passageshavebeenprovided,andthetunnelhasbeenequippedwithalinearfiredetectionsystem,smokeandheatextractionfans,camerasurveillance,accesscontrolbymeansofabadgesystem,guaranteed(redundant)electricalpower,agasdetectionsystem,firehydrants,theASTRIDcommunicationsystemfortheemergencyservices,aBuildingManagementSystemandanautomaticgasandfirescenarioPLClinkedtothesignals.

Raising the height of platformsThe management contract between the Belgian state and Infrabel stipulates that accessibility to the infrastructure for travelers must be improved. For this purpose, Infrabel has drawn up a plan for the “systematic improvement of accessibility to platforms”. This plan is based on three principles: installing elevators and wheelchair ramps on the platforms, the installation of warning and guide lines and raising the height of the platforms.
Duringthe2009to2022period,Infrabelwillraisetheheightofplatformsin160stationsandstops.Theseplatformswillalsobeequippedwithwarningandguidelines.73%oftravelerswillbeabletouseraisedplatforms.Toachievethisambitiousplan,InfrabelhasentrustedTUCRAILwithresponsibilityforoverallprogrammanagementaswellasthedesignandexecutionofacertainnumberofprojectswhicharenotcarriedoutbyInfrabel.
TUCRAILtakesthefollowingstepswhenraisingtheheightofaplatform:drawingupapreliminarydesign,applyingforplanningpermissionandcompulsorypurchaseorders(wheretheplatformsaremoved),compilingthetechnicalspecifications,awardingthecontractandexecutionoftheworks.

The re-electrification works on Line 162 are part of an overall modernization of the Infrabel managed line. The purpose of this modernization is to reduce journey times on the line.
InfrabelhasputTUCRAILinchargeofdesign,supervisionoftheworksandmanagementofthere-electrificationofL162betweenNamurandtheLuxembourgborder.
Theseworksconsistofacompleterenewaloftheoverheadlineinfrastructure.Thespecialfeatureofthisnewtypeofoverheadline,theconceptforwhichwasdevelopedbyTUCRAIL,isthatitismixed.Thismeansthatitiscompatiblewiththeexisting3kVdirectcurrentpowersupply(classiclines)butalsowiththefuture25kValternatingcurrentpowersupply.

Special work for InfrabelTUC RAIL also carries out special work for Infrabel outside the general framework of traditional infrastructural works.
GSM-R: communications and safetyTUCRAILisactivelyinvolvedinthedevelopmentoftheGSM-R(GSMforRailways)networkinBelgium.TheGSM-RnetworkformspartoftheEuropeanERTMS(EuropeanRailTrafficManagementSystem).Thissystemenablesmovementauthorizationsandspeedinstructionstobetransmittedfromthesignalboxesanddisplayedonthedrivers’dashboards.Besidesthemediumfortransmissionofrailsignals,theGSM-Ralsoenablestrafficsafetyingeneral,andthesafetyofemployeesandcompaniesworkingalongthetracksinparticular,tobeimproved.IncollaborationwithICTRA(ICTforRail,ICTdepartmentofSNCB-Holding),TUCRAILisresponsibleforpreliminarystudies,buildingpermitfiles,stabilitystudiesandmonitoringtheworkontheGSM-Rmasts.Around350mastshavebeenerected.Around140mastsbelongingtootheroperatorshavealsobeenmodified.Finally,weareexaminingthepossibilityofusingeightynewmaststodeployETCS2(EuropeanTrainControlSystem)onthelinesinquestion.
Business Continuity StrategyThenotionof“BusinessContinuity”referstothecontinuityofacompany’sbusinessanditsanticipationofwhatstepstotaketoensurethatitsbusinesscontinuesunderthebestconditionspossible.TheBusinessContinuityStrategyprogramsfortheNord-MidijunctioninBrusselsandtheKennedytunnelinAntwerpwereentrustedtoTUCRAILbyInfrabelin2009.Theseprogramsinvolvebringingtheoperationalavailabilityoftheexistingstructuresinlinewiththatofothermoderntunnelsincompliancewithcurrentstandardsandrecommendations.AfeasibilitystudywascarriedoutbytheTUCRAILteamstodefinethesafetyandavailabilitymeasuresrequiredtoguaranteethecontinuedoperationofthesestructuresandtoproposethestaggeringoftheworksovertwosuccessivephasesintegratedintoavastupgradeprogramoftheexistingrailinfrastructurebetweenBrussels-NordandBrussels-Midi.

Expertise in high speed projects abroadWhile best known for being the company that developed the high speed rail network in Belgium, TUC RAIL is also collaborating on the development of the high speed network at the international level, notably in Spain, France and Saudi Arabia.
SpainTheexpertiseofTUCRAILwasrelieduponforthelayingofaround44.5kmofhighspeedline(HSL)betweentheFrenchcityofPerpignanandtheSpanishtownofFigueres.Thetrainsonthislineareintendedtocarrybothpassengersandfreightatspeedsof350km/hand120km/hrespectively.Workswerecarriedoutbetween2004and2009.
TUCRAILcontributedtotheresearchanddevelopmentofthetechnicalaspectofthesystem(preliminaryandfinaldesign),theapprovaloftheimplementationstudiesandthesupervisionandinspectionofactivitiesintheareasofsafety,RAMS(Reliability,Availability,Maintainability,Safety),track,signaling,telecommunications,overheadlinesanddynamictestingTUCRAILalsoprovidedtechnicalassistanceduringthepreparationsoftheoperationsmanagement,themaintenanceandthetestingandvalidationprocedure,aswellasthecreationofthefinalRAMSfile.
ThePerpignan-Figueresprojectwascomplexanddifficult(differenttrackgauges,legislation,technicalnormsandstandards,etc.).TheprojectenabledTUCRAILtoworkatthelevelofbothafranchiseeandanengineeringgroup.Thankstothisproject,TUCRAILwasalsoabletofamiliarizeitselfwithworkingwithinthecontextofaPublic-Private

FranceTUCRAILiscurrentlyworkingontwomajorprojects:theHSLSudEurope-AtlantiqueandtheHSLBretagne-PaysdelaLoire.
ThehighspeedlineSudEurope-Atlantique(HSLSEA)betweenToursandBordeauxwillcomprise340kmofnewlines,madeupof302kmofhighspeedlinesandaround40kilometresofconnectionstotheexistingline.
Aspartofthisproject,anIndependentTechnicalOrganization(ITO)hasbeenappointed.Itstaskistoassesstechnicalconformityandcompliancewiththeobligationsforsustainabledevelopmentforallofthetechnicalandenvironmentalareasrelatingtothedesignandconstructionofthenewline.ItwasTUCRAIL,inpartnership,thatwasappointedtocarryoutthismission.Tothisenditisresponsiblewithinthispartnershipforassessingthetechnicalequipment.Thismissionincludesassessingtheconformityofstudies,assessingtheconformityofwork,formulationofopinionsforallprojectassessments,compliancewiththequalityblueprintandtheenvironmentalqualityplan,assistancewithinfrastructurereceptionoperationsandsupervisionofprogress.
ThefuturehighspeedlineBretagne-PaysdelaLoire(HSLBPL)betweenLeMansandRenneswillbe182kminlength,towhichwillbeadded32kmofconnections.ItwillextendthecurrenthighspeedlinebetweenParisandLeMans,whichis180kmlongandwentintoservicein1989.
Aspartofthisproject,TUCRAILishelpingcarryoutaspecialprojectmanagement(SPM)missionforthefixedinstallationsforelectrictraction(overheadlineandpowersupplystudies).Thismissionisbeingcarriedoutincooperationwithapartner.

Saudi ArabiaTheHaramainHighSpeedRailProjectconsistsofthedesignandconstructionofa444kmdouble-trackhighspeedlinebetweenMeccaandMedinainSaudiArabia.
InMarch2009,theSaudiRailwayOrganization(SRO)awardedthecontractforthecivilengineeringwork,retainingwalls,underpasses,constructionofbridges,viaducts,tracksandearthmovingwork,etc.totheAl-RahjiAllianceconsortium.
Againstthisbackdrop,inJuneofthatyear,TUCRAILsignedatechnicalassistanceagreementwiththeLebaneseengineeringfirmKhatib&Alami,amemberoftheAl-RahjiAllianceconsortium.Thiscontractprovidesforad-hocmissionsasaconsultantandexpertonhighspeedlines.Todate,TUCRAILhasactedasconsultantandexpertforaroundfifty“WorkPackages”concerning,forexample,therevisionofthedesigncriteriaandtechnicaldocuments,andthecivilengineering.
TUCRAILalsoexecutedthepreliminarydesignandthefinaldesignforthe“MakkahFlare”viaductthatenablesthenewhighspeedlinetoenterMeccastation.
